How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Role: Safety, Health and Environment Advisor 
    Salary: £40,000 – £45,000 per annum *DOE + enhanced pension, benefits and bonus
    Location: Tutbury, Burton on Trent
    Working Hours: 37.5 hours per week

    Seeking a hands on, dynamic and people centric professional to provide safety, health and support alongside an experienced SHE Manager (also based on site). This position is perfect for an experienced Health Safety and Environment coordinator/ officer/ advisor who can hit the ground running for this large and well established and invested, 24/7 manufacturing site. 

    Main responsibilities:
    To be responsible for supporting the SHE Manager in all aspects of health, safety and environment across site, covering for the Manager when required.
    Be a valued person within an established HSE team, who can be visible and approachable across the site and bring innovative and forward-thinking ideas to the table
    Establish trusted relationships with the community and external stakeholders
    Support incident investigations & reporting as required helping to provide root cause analysis and corrective actions.
    Enhance current levels of compliance - Support the maintenance of the factory SHE Management systems including maintaining ISO14001, ISO50001 and ISO45001 certification. With a focus on Safety and Health compliance and proactive management.
    Collaborate across departments, specifically working closely with different teams to ensure compliance and highlight areas of improvement to enhance SHE across the site.
    Implement & develop site initiatives leading to continuous improvement in SHE performance                                                                           
    Essential qualifications, skills and experience:

    Essential - NEBOSH General Certificate or equivalent Health and Safety qualification ie, IOSH Level 3 
    Ideally general engineering, manufacturing experience, fast paced manufacturing or logistics background, high risk industries are included. Ideally FMCG( food drink, paper, packaging, tobacco, dairy etc.)
    Ideal personality traits:

    Self-motivated and confident person
    Hands on, able to build trusted relationships
    Able to collaborate, influence, gain buy -in with strong communication skills
